Thermal fatigue characterization of epoxy resin

We are studying about the evaluation method of thermal fatigue characteristics for the epoxy resin for mold used as the mechanical protection and the electric insulation material of electrical and electric equipment. Since the strength of an epoxy resin is strongly dependent on temperature, when obtaining repetition thermal stress with starting and stopping of product, it becomes reverse phase type thermal fatigue problem. Then, paying attention to strong temperature dependency, the technique of predicting thermal-fatigue characteristics from the machine fatigue characteristics under constant temperature is proposed, and the validity based on a metal-fatigue mechanism is verified. By the result of research, the rational choice of a rational design and an epoxy resin to a thermal fatigue is made possible.
